VERIFY INFORMATION Now you are at Step 2 of the Checkout Process - Verifying your order. This is where payment information is collected. Here you will see any shipping and handling charges that are added to the order - based on what you choose to charge as the merchant. Also, note the 'locked' paddlelock in your browser's status window. This ensures your customer that they are entering confidential information over a secure connection. Information entered under this method is encrypted for security reasons. Upon clicking 'Check Out', the purchasing transaction will be complete and you, the merchant, will receive the order request. The 'customer' will receive a confirmation email, indicating that the order has been placed and detailing the item(s) purchased. (If you filled in a valid e-mail address in the Customer Information section of the form, a copy of this demo's order request email will be sent to you - check your email inbox). You, the merchant, would then receive notification of the sale so that you could fulfill the order request. We will review the Merchant Tools in the next section of this tutorial.
